Output 52138e49e70a4f881f1574968cef3497c3770adc111c4d1be9b0e5ea99dfb97c:2

value
866378008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87e090428b7568d9df533ad3302c72c643908fb OP_EQUAL
address
3MRis4R8BTB1GmkgxBW1grw31JhrFyi35s
transaction
52138e49e70a4f881f1574968cef3497c3770adc111c4d1be9b0e5ea99dfb97c
spent
true